Wheeler Lake is a stillwater in the Lower Arrow Lake watershed, Expansion of Lendrum Creek, just E of Kokanee Glacier Provincial Park, N of Nelson. ~15.8 ha surface area.

The water

Wheeler Lake lies Expansion of Lendrum Creek, just E of Kokanee Glacier Provincial Park, N of Nelson; in the Lower Arrow Lake watershed. It covers ~15.8 ha surface area. The lake survey puts it at max 10.4 m, which sets the depth you fish.

The fishing

Wheeler Lake fishes on classic stillwater lines: chironomids over the shoals, leech and attractor retrieves along the drop-offs, and depth or troll work to the shoal-and-drop-off structure. Match the season and confirm against a local report.

Conditions

  • Depth: max 10.4 m, Secchi 8.8 m (BC lake survey 1974-08-27).
  • Water-health signal: good (health index 15), 2 species over 7 observations.
